上次我们介绍了:Oracle数据库rman常用命令的使用示例,本文我们介绍一下Oracle数据库rman环境配置的过程,接下来就让我们一起来了解一下这部分内容吧!

为绍兴等地区用户提供了全套网页设计制作服务,及绍兴网站建设行业解决方案。主营业务为成都做网站、网站设计、绍兴网站设计,以传统方式定制建设网站,并提供域名空间备案等一条龙服务,秉承以专业、用心的态度为用户提供真诚的服务。我们深信只要达到每一位用户的要求,就会得到认可,从而选择与我们长期合作。这样,我们也可以走得更远!
1.配置自动通道
配置自动通道并行度,RMAN自动分配2个通道:
- RMAN> configure device type disk parallelism 2;
 - RMAN> configure device type sbt parallelism 2;
 
配置所有通道的备份文件格式
- RMAN> configure channel device type disk
 - 2> format '/oracle/10g/oracle/bakup/%d_%s_%p.bak';
 
配置特定通道的备份文件格式,配置通道1备份文件格式:
- RMAN> configure channel 1 device type disk
 - 2> format '/oracle/10g/oracle/bakup/%u.bak';
 
配置默认存储设备
- RMAN> configure default device type to sbt; --磁带
 - RMAN> configure default device type to disk;--磁盘
 
2.配置备份集与备份片的最大尺寸
- RMAN> configure maxsetsize to 1G;
 - RMAN> configure channel device type disk maxpiecesize 500M;
 
默认每个备份集只包含一个备份片文件,通过配置备份片的最大尺寸,可以将一个大的备份集分为几个相对小的备份片文件。
3.配置备份优化
备份优化用于在某些情况下跳过特定文件的备份。如果某个文件完全相同的备份已经存在,那么当激活备份优化时会跳过该文件。备份优化只适用于backup database,backup archivelog all/like和backup backupset all命令。激活备份优化:RMAN> configure backup optimization on;
4.配置多重备份
rman默认生成一个备份片副本,可以配置多重备份。示例:
- RMAN> configure datafile backup copies for device type disk to 3;
 
5.配置免除表空间
- RMAN> configure exclude for tablespace testspc;
 
6.配置备份冗余策略
使用delete obsolete删除陈旧备份,配置备份冗余策略示例:
- RMAN> configure retention policy to redundancy 2;
 
7.配置辅助例程的数据文件名
用于rman执行表空间时间点恢复或复制数据库,示例:
- RMAN> configure auxname for datafile 2 to '/oracle/10g/data/df_2.dbf';
 
8.配置快照控制文件名
当重新同步恢复目录或备份控制文件时,rman需要建立快照控制文件。
- RMAN> show snapshot controlfile name;
 - RMAN configuration parameters are:
 - CONFIGURE SNAPSHOT CONTROLFILE NAME TO '/oracle/10g/oracle/product/10.2.0/db_1/dbs/snapcf_oralife.f'; # default --默认
 - RMAN> configure snapshot controlfile name to '/oracle/10g/oracle/product/10.2.0/db_1/dbs/snapcf_oralife_test.f';
 - snapshot control file name set to: /oracle/10g/oracle/product/10.2.0/db_1/dbs/snapcf_oralife_test.f
 - new RMAN configuration parameters are successfully stored
 - RMAN> show snapshot controlfile name;
 - RMAN configuration parameters are:
 - CONFIGURE SNAPSHOT CONTROLFILE NAME TO '/oracle/10g/oracle/product/10.2.0/db_1/dbs/snapcf_oralife_test.f';
 
9.显示rman配置
显示所有rman环境配置:RMAN> show all;
显示默认设备类型:RMAN> show default device type;
显示自动通道配置:RMAN> show channel for device type disk/sbt;
显示备份冗余策略:RMAN> show retention policy;
显示备份优化:RMAN> show backup optimization;
显示快照控制文件:RMAN> show snapshot controlfile name;
显示备份集最大尺寸:RMAN> show maxsetsize;
显示多重备份:
- RMAN> show datafile backup copies; --显示数据文件多重备份
 - RMAN> show archivelog backup copies;--显示归档日志多重备份
 
10.清除rman配置
使用clear选项清除rman配置,示例:
- RMAN> configure retention policy clear;
 - old RMAN configuration parameters:
 - CONFIGURE RETENTION POLICY TO REDUNDANCY 2;
 - RMAN configuration parameters are successfully reset to default value
 - RMAN> show retention policy;
 - RMAN configuration parameters are:
 - CONFIGURE RETENTION POLICY TO REDUNDANCY 1; # default
 
关于Oracle数据库rman环境配置的知识就介绍到这里了,希望本次的介绍能够对您有所帮助。
【编辑推荐】
Copyright © 2009-2022 www.wtcwzsj.com 青羊区广皓图文设计工作室(个体工商户) 版权所有 蜀ICP备19037934号